Mammoth Cave National Park Tours Not Affected By White-Nose Syndrome
![](https://www.nationalparkstraveler.org/sites/default/files/styles/npt_square2/public/default_images/npt_icons_0.png?itok=8J64sZS9)
White-nose syndrome continues to be a serious problem in many bat populations in eastern states. Fortunately, the disease has not appeared at Mammoth Cave National Park, and the underground tours are continuing as usual.
